Output 94d59b23d539b1776d5c74caa9abd9f70ef9429bed58f25ba5ba416015595706:9
- value
- 11035139
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f5ddc9f1b0ee511d617d4ae164bf10868aff575 OP_EQUAL
- address
- 3K8sRpGSbF78hv4eiNX4mcnVJzHUb2eUve
- transaction
- 94d59b23d539b1776d5c74caa9abd9f70ef9429bed58f25ba5ba416015595706
- confirmations
- 346188
- spent
- true